- The distance between Hanover, Nh, Usa and Walhalla, Sc, Usa is approximately 1,397 km or 868 mi.
- To reach Hanover, Nh in this distance one would set out from Walhalla, Sc bearing 39.4°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Hanover, Nh bearing 46.4° or NE .
- Hanover, Nh has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Walhalla, Sc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Hanover, Nh is in or near the boreal rain forest biome whereas Walhalla, Sc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 7.6 °C (13.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.8 °C (15.8°F) more in Hanover, Nh.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 613.9 mm (24.2 in) less which is equivalent to 613.9 l/m² (15.07 US gal/ft²) or 6,139,000 l/ha (656,300 US gal/ac) less. About 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.2° lower in Hanover, Nh than in Walhalla, Sc.
